Output 597616f453026c6000cbf222ae947c67b3fa95894db5e3ce620ab5f7dcb21d1a:1

value
6244701
script pubkey
OP_0 OP_PUSHBYTES_20 2838e962ddc53fd2b37f533cde28b4f1a04529b5
address
bc1q9quwjckac5la9vml2v7du2957xsy22d4z2q62x
transaction
597616f453026c6000cbf222ae947c67b3fa95894db5e3ce620ab5f7dcb21d1a
spent
true